1.0

Boring. Forgettable story, forgettable characters, forgettable ending. The title and the blurb are misleading. The supposed love story between the two main characters is not immersive, I am not rooting for them from the start, it’s just plain. Too many side characters with too much irrelevant details make the story boring and I had the urge to give the book up many times during my reading. The author picks up all the imaginable topics existing in the world and tries to tackle them all in one book which makes no sense. It’s all jumbled up. There are so many parts of the book which if you don’t read won’t really affect your understanding of the book and you won’t miss out on a single thing. It was an effort to read this book. There is not a single thing I liked about this book. Predictable ending to various stories within the novel, vague overall ending which did not excite me or made me happy for any of the character. I think it could have been written in a much condensed and better way. The length of the book is not at all justified, whatever the author wanted to say could have been said in mere 200-250 pages and that might have been more interesting.

Me encantó!!! Aunque hasta el final quise pegarle a la protagonista 😡 
Al principio pensé “faltan 450 páginas, ¿de qué más puede hablar la autora?”, pero oh boy, estaba por entrar a un viaje… la historia tiene muchos personajes, pero creo que cada uno de ellos le da al relato fuerza y, si me pongo a pensar, creo que ninguno es imprescindible.
Entras a la historia pensando que vas a leer sobre un par de personas y, en realidad, la autora te cuenta sobre la historia de una familia inmigrante y como cada uno de sus miembros vive su vida en un país que aún los ve como “otros”. Tiene temas serios, pero hablados desde un lenguaje coloquial, cercano, porque son experiencias que se ven en el día a día, pero sin perder la idea de que, finalmente, es un libro ligero… ligero, pero que habla de temas importantes y no los deja sueltos sin resolución, sino que los entreteje dentro del relato principal porque así sucede en la vida.

Yasmin es una médica de ascendencia india que se va a casar, por amor, con un médico inglés. Las familias se conocerán y, a pesar que de ambos lados miran al otro con ciertos ojos “idealizadores”, la realidad familiar interna de las dos familias es bastante compleja, aunque incluso los mismos miembros de la familia no lo sepan o no lo noten. A lo largo de la historia, la lectora conocerá estas complejidades de la mano de sus protagonistas y luego de la tormenta, veremos si queda algo de donde se pueda volver a construir.
